How we calculate this

Solar generation: Based on typical south-facing roof at 35° angle. We account for weather, dirt, and system losses (14%).

How much you'll use directly:

  • Without battery: You'll use about 40% of what you generate. The rest gets sold back to the grid.
  • With 5 kWh battery: You'll use about 70% (battery stores extra for evening use).
  • With 10 kWh battery: You'll use about 75% (more storage means less exported).
  • Panel-only payback: Bigger systems don’t shorten payback—cost and savings rise together per kW.
  • Battery & payback: Batteries raise self-use and cut bills, but added hardware cost often lengthens break-even at typical UK rates.
  • When a battery can still make sense:
    • Evening-heavy usage patterns
    • Time-of-use tariffs / cheap night rates
    • Low export rate vs. high unit rate
    • Heat pump or EV charging synergy
    • Optional backup/resilience (system-dependent)
    • Lower evening-hour CO₂ vs. grid

Costs: Battery prices are typically £700 per kWh. Export tariffs vary by supplier (usually 5–15p per kWh).

Grid connection: Systems up to about 3.7 kW typically need just a notification (G98). Larger systems may need permission (G99).

These are typical values based on average usage patterns. Your actual results will vary based on your roof, shading, and how you use electricity.

Your area in context

Read the full story

A typical roof here lands around 6.0 kW, with most eligible homes comfortably fitting within 3–6 kW. Each kilowatt of panels produces roughly 993 kWh per year on a south-facing roof. We value self-used electricity at 25.6p and exported surplus at a baseline 10p via SEG. Use the calculator above for your exact tariff.

Browse the scenarios below. Each battery size has its own expand — open the one that matches your plan (or just explore). For each system size (2–8 kW) we show annual output, how much you use directly, what gets exported, annual benefit, upfront cost, break-even, and a 20-year net. Negative numbers are possible — that’s the honest trade-off when adding more battery than your usage profile justifies.

No battery 5 kW example → Annual benefit: £805, Upfront: £10,173, Break-even: 12.6 yrs
System Annual output Self-use Exported Bill saving Export income Annual benefit Upfront cost Break-even 20-year net
2 kW 1986 kWh 794 kWh 1191 kWh £203 £119 £322 £4,069 12.6 yrs £2,372
3 kW 2978 kWh 1191 kWh 1787 kWh £304 £179 £483 £6,104 12.6 yrs £3,558
4 kW 3971 kWh 1588 kWh 2383 kWh £406 £238 £644 £8,138 12.6 yrs £4,744
5 kW 4964 kWh 1986 kWh 2978 kWh £507 £298 £805 £10,173 12.6 yrs £5,930
6 kW 5957 kWh 2383 kWh 3574 kWh £609 £357 £966 £12,207 12.6 yrs £7,116
7 kW 6949 kWh 2780 kWh 4170 kWh £710 £417 £1,127 £14,242 12.6 yrs £8,302
8 kW 7942 kWh 3177 kWh 4765 kWh £812 £477 £1,288 £16,276 12.6 yrs £9,489

Assumptions: south-facing, sensible tilt; self-use shares from site rules; export at 10p baseline. Costs: panels £/kW = 2,035, battery £/kWh = 700.

Data Sources & Assumptions

Solar yield: PVGIS (EU Joint Research Centre), January 2025 data

Electricity rates: Ofgem price cap, Q4 2025

Installation costs: MCS certified installer data, March 2025

Property data: EPC open data (Open Government Licence), aggregated

All estimates are typical values. Actual results vary based on your specific situation, roof characteristics, and usage patterns.
